轻量服务器与大型程序:一场容量与效能的对话
结论:轻量服务器在理论上是可以搭建大型程序的,但实际操作中需要考虑诸多因素,包括但不限于程序的规模、资源需求、性能优化以及服务器的扩展性。轻量服务器可能无法满足所有大型程序的运行需求,但在适当的技术支持和优化下,它们可以成为一种可行且经济的解决方案。
正文:
在数字化的时代,服务器作为互联网服务的基石,其选择直接影响到应用程序的运行效率和用户体验。轻量服务器因其低功耗、低成本和易于管理等特性,受到了许多小型企业和初创公司的青睐。然而,当面对大型程序时,我们不禁要问:轻量服务器真的能胜任吗?
首先,我们需要明确何为“大型程序”。大型程序通常指的是那些需要处理大量数据、并发用户多、计算需求复杂的应用,如电商网站、社交平台或大数据分析系统。这些程序对服务器的硬件配置、内存、带宽和存储空间有较高要求。
轻量服务器,顾名思义,其硬件配置相对较低,内存和CPU资源有限。在不进行任何优化的情况下,试图在这样的服务器上运行大型程序可能会导致性能瓶颈,甚至无法正常运行。然而,这并不意味着轻量服务器就无法承载大型程序。
一方面,通过技术手段,如代码优化、负载均衡和分布式计算,我们可以将大型程序的压力分散到多个轻量服务器上,实现集群化运行。例如,使用微服务架构,将大型程序拆分成多个小的服务,每个服务都可以在独立的轻量服务器上运行,从而提高整体系统的稳定性和可扩展性。
另一方面,云服务提供商如AWS、Azure和Google Cloud等提供了灵活的资源调整选项,可以根据程序的实际需求动态调整服务器资源,使得轻量服务器也能应对高峰期的流量压力。
然而,这并不意味着轻量服务器是大型程序的最佳选择。在某些情况下,如处理高并发、大数据量的场景,或者程序本身对硬件性能有极高要求,重型服务器或者专用的硬件设备可能更为合适。此外,轻量服务器的运维成本虽然低,但其性能和稳定性可能不如专业服务器,对于业务连续性和用户体验有高要求的企业,这可能是一个需要权衡的问题。
总结来说,轻量服务器能否搭建大型程序,并非一个简单的Yes或No的问题。它取决于程序的具体需求、服务器的优化程度、云服务的灵活性以及企业的运营策略。在技术的推动下,轻量服务器正逐步挑战着传统观念,它们在满足部分大型程序运行需求的同时,也为企业提供了更经济、灵活的解决方案。但同时,我们也应意识到,选择适合的服务器,就像选择合适的鞋子,关键在于是否合脚,而非大小。